What is the Trial Judicial
The Trial Judicial is a legal process that allows parties to resolve disputes following arbitration. It serves as a mechanism for parties to seek a trial de novo, which means a new trial is conducted as if the arbitration had not occurred. This process is particularly relevant in California, where specific rules govern how a request for judicial review can be made after arbitration. Understanding this process is crucial for individuals and businesses looking to navigate legal disputes effectively.

Steps to Complete the Trial Judicial
Completing the Trial Judicial requires adherence to a series of structured steps:
- Review the arbitration award and determine the grounds for seeking a trial de novo.
- Prepare the necessary documentation, including the request for trial and any supporting evidence.
- File the request with the appropriate court within the designated timeframe, typically within 30 days of the arbitration award.
- Serve the opposing party with a copy of the filed request.
- Attend any preliminary hearings as required by the court.
Following these steps ensures that your request is properly submitted and increases the likelihood of a favorable outcome.
